Introduction

The Veda’s are the unique heritage of the ancient tradition of Indian wisdom. They do not only contain all knowledge of existence and evolution, but they also offer many practical applications, including the original approach of Vedic Astrology. In this Vocational Training of Vedic Astrology we are taught both spiritual and practical skills in order to function as a consultant in this fascinating field. We will learn with that part of the Indian Astrology that involves analysis and prediction based on the Vedic birthchart. This implies that we will be learning extensively about the characteristics of the planets, zodiacal signs and houses and the varied effects that their interactions have on our lifes.

Target Group

The training Consultant Vedic Astrology is meant for students who want to to guide men spiritually, formulate their destination and give advice on their path of life and in work.

Study Goals

Vedic Astrology or ‘Jyotish’ has been emerged from the primordial principle that all natural phenomena in time and space occur with great precision in such a way that these cycles can be perfectly calculated and the effects of any interactions can be analysed and predicted.
The main purpose of the Training is to guide the student in analyzing the Vedic birthchart and to relate this knowledge to the belonging periods of peoples lifes. Vedic Astrology gives tremendous insight to a client as a life agenda, showing the life path clearly and as a spiritual guide. Moreover, Vedic Astrology provides a number of natural remedies to balance or neutralize any planetairy effect which causes an obstacle in life.

Explanation Studyprogramme

pdfStudy Programme

The subject-matter of teaching is offered and explained step by step in 22 modules (lessons) in a very systematical way. Every module consists of a number of sheets together with questions and assignments. The student is asked to send the answers of the questions and assignments back to the tutor who will give his comments and discusses the subject-matter with the student. If necessary the tutor’s review can take place by skype and after this a new module will be offered to the student.

After the successful study of the 22 modules of the Vocational Training the student is asked to write a Thesis of 30-40 pages. For each module 50 sbu points will be awarded and 75 sbu points for the Thesis = 1175 sbu points totally. After the successful completing of the Vocational Training and Thesis the Dutch University College/DUC Educational Centre facilitates the student with a diploma Master Consultant Vedic Astrology (conform Master CVA).
